Wednesday, February 25 2026 - Tonto Dikeh has publicly celebrated and prayed for her former husband, Olakunle Churchill, during their son King Andre’s 10th birthday party held in Abuja.
Video from the event, now circulating widely online, showed
the Nollywood actress offering heartfelt prayers for Churchill, speaking words
of prosperity, protection and divine favour over him and his household.
“You are an amazing father, thank you so much,” she said.
“Your businesses will flourish; whoever curses you shall be
cursed. I love you with the love of God.”
Dikeh also spoke about the strong relationship between
Churchill and their son, stressing that Andre has deep love and admiration for
his father.
She extended her prayers to Churchill’s family, including
his other children, asking for progress, success and protection from failure in
all their endeavours.
“I pray for your family. I pray for your business. I pray
for all the children. They will progress. Failure will not meet them.
Everything that they touch will be blessed,” she said.
“God will go before them and make every crooked path
straight. Your business is replenished.”
Dikeh and Churchill were once married before their widely
publicised separation in 2017.
Recently, however, the actress announced that they had
reconciled and “buried the hatchet,” bringing an end to their prolonged public
dispute.
In 2021, Churchill formally introduced Rosy Meurer, his
former personal assistant, as his wife. The couple welcomed their first child
in March 2021 and a second child in October 2022.
Churchill also addressed and dismissed speculation about
trouble in his marriage in 2023.
Meurer
recently professed her deep loyalty to her husband, stating that she would
willingly “take a bullet” for him.
